			<description><![CDATA[Season 2 of the Nordic Future Makers podcast kicks off by talking to Thomas Hellum from Norway's NRK TV channel - with a little help from Barack Obama.  This is the story of Slow TV.  The story of how a Norwegian TV broadcaster ended up creating some of the longest and most watched shows in Norwegian TV history.  This has started a trend of Slow TV across the world and Thomas tells us how the idea for Slow TV came about and how it has developed - a nice 'slow' start to the second series as we finish our summer vacations and head back to work again. 			<itunes:image href="https://assets.pippa.io/shows/5e6e96d1abbcafac647b980a/1584316243342-213c4b377a962a41ab6763ad8d43007b.jpeg"/>
			<description><![CDATA[<p>Ben Liebmann, COO, restaurant noma is my guest on the Nordic Future Makers podcast this week. noma is the four-time winner of the S. Pellegrino World’s Best Restaurant, founded by trailblazing and critically-acclaimed head chef René Redzepi. Opened in 2003 and based within a Bjarke Ingels designed urban farm located in the Copenhagen neighbourhood of Christiania (the self-proclaimed free-town of the city), the multiple Michelin starred restaurant is recognised globally for its reinvention and interpretation of Nordic Cuisine.</p><br><p>In this podcast Ben talks of his career journey that has taken him across the world from music to telecoms to TV to noma. He talks eloquently about developing brands and multi-channel businesses and balancing creativity and commerciality, referencing his experiences with Idol and Masterchef, before going into more detail around his current role and the business of restaurant noma. .</p><br><p>At the end of this podcast we talk about the effects of covid-19 and plans for the future.
